Tailored Treatments through Genetic Understanding
The frontier of medicine is rapidly evolving with the rise of personalized medicine. This revolutionary approach harnesses the strength of DNA insights to customize treatments specifically for each patient. By analyzing an individual's genetic code, physicians can uncover potential vulnerabilities to certain diseases and adjust treatment plans accordingly.
This focused approach check here offers a spectrum of benefits, including enhanced treatment outcomes, lowered side effects, and heightened patient well-being. With each breakthrough in genetic research, personalized medicine promises to change the way we treat diseases, ushering in a new era of healthcare that is truly patient-centered.

The Ethical Implications of DNA Testing
The extensive proliferation of accessible DNA testing products has ignited a controversy concerning its ethical consequences. While these tests offer valuable insights into our heritage, they also raise complex questions regarding confidentiality. The potential for genetic discrimination is a significant concern, as insurers could exploit genetic insights to their benefit. Moreover, the revelation of unexpected connections can transform existing familial relationships, leading to difficult situations. It is essential that we navigate this brave new world of genetics with prudence, ensuring that the advantages outweigh the potential harms.
